Position Overview

The Senior Event Specialist is a key leader within Encore’s Event Design & Decor Department, responsible for independently managing and designing events from concept to execution. This includes both external client events and internal Encore-led initiatives. The role combines strategic thinking, creative vision, and operational expertise to deliver impactful event experiences that align with brand goals and elevate the attendee experience.

Senior Event Specialists lead the development of creative concepts, design execution, vendor coordination, and on-site management, while also mentoring junior staff and contributing to department growth.

Key Job Responsibilities

Project Leadership & Execution

• Lead end-to-end management of assigned events, including design and execution for both Encore-produced and client events.

• Translate creative briefs into high-impact, visually compelling events.

• Manage timelines, budgets, and detailed workback schedules.

• Act as the on-site lead for installations and live event execution, ensuring alignment with the vision and event goals.

• Anticipate and resolve issues with agility and professionalism.

Event Design

• Create custom design concepts, floorplans, mood boards, and visual presentations for internal Encore events and external client projects.

• Design visual elements such as staging, signage, floral, furniture layouts, and thematic décor.

• Ensure cohesive storytelling and brand alignment in all design aspects.

• Collaborate with the internal creative team, production, and digital departments to bring designs to life.

• Maintain awareness of industry trends to develop fresh, innovative design approaches.

Client & Vendor Management

• Serve as the lead contact for assigned clients, offering creative direction and ongoing communication.

• Source and manage vendors for décor, floral, rentals, entertainment, and more.

• Oversee all procurement processes including purchase orders, quoting, and invoicing.

• Cultivate strong relationships with venues and partners to enhance execution capabilities.

Team Collaboration & Mentorship

• Guide and mentor Junior Event Specialists and Coordinators in both design and logistics.

• Support onboarding and knowledge sharing within the department.

• Collaborate closely with production, sales, and digital teams to ensure seamless delivery.

Reporting & Tools

• Track and report on project performance using Polaris, Resource Manager, SmartSheet, and Microsoft Office tools.

• Support month-end reporting and department planning.

• Lead inventory strategy for design elements and décor items in collaboration with warehouse teams.

Job Qualifications

• A bachelor’s degree (BS/BA) in a related field is preferred but not required.

• 4–6 years of experience in event design, planning, or production.

• Demonstrated ability to design and manage both internal and external events.

• Strong visual storytelling and design sensibility.

• Exceptional communication, leadership, and organizational skills.

• Experience with Microsoft Office; Polaris and SmartSheet knowledge an asset.

• Ability to manage multiple events simultaneously with creativity and precision.

Hourly Pay Range: $35 - $38

The compensation offered for this role is determined based on the qualifications outlined in the job posting for the specified location. Final compensation is based on a number of factors including location, travel, relevant work experience, or particular skills and expertise. In addition, some positions may be eligible for other compensation such as potential overtime, bonuses or incentives.



Work Environment

Hotel

Work is performed in a hotel/convention center environment with moderate exposure to outdoor temperatures and to dirt, sand and/or dust. The working conditions will vary between moderately quiet to noisy volumes. Team members will use high-end audio-visual equipment and electrical components and will be exposed to heights via lifts and ladders. Team members may be asked to work in multiple hotel locations. Working times will include irregular hours and on-call status including days, evenings, weekends, and holidays. Team members must adhere to appearance guidelines as defined by Encore based on an individual hotel or a representation of hotels in that city or area.

Office

Work is performed primarily in an office environment. Working times may include irregular hours and on-call status including days, evenings, weekends, and holidays. Team members must adhere to appearance guidelines as defined by Encore based in an office environment and when traveling, on an individual venue or a representation of venues in that city or area.
